forked from Minki/linux
toshiba: use ioremap_cached
The switch of ioremap to default to uncached doesn't break this driver but it does needlessly slow it down as BIOS space is cachable and this driver is quite happy scanning cached ROM space. Signed-off-by: Alan Cox <alan@redhat.com> Signed-off-by: Ingo Molnar <mingo@elte.hu> Signed-off-by: Thomas Gleixner <tglx@linutronix.de>
This commit is contained in:
parent
2544a873ab
commit
1dcf83fd0c
@ -426,7 +426,7 @@ static int tosh_probe(void)
|
|||||||
int i,major,minor,day,year,month,flag;
|
int i,major,minor,day,year,month,flag;
|
||||||
unsigned char signature[7] = { 0x54,0x4f,0x53,0x48,0x49,0x42,0x41 };
|
unsigned char signature[7] = { 0x54,0x4f,0x53,0x48,0x49,0x42,0x41 };
|
||||||
SMMRegisters regs;
|
SMMRegisters regs;
|
||||||
void __iomem *bios = ioremap(0xf0000, 0x10000);
|
void __iomem *bios = ioremap_cache(0xf0000, 0x10000);
|
||||||
|
|
||||||
if (!bios)
|
if (!bios)
|
||||||
return -ENOMEM;
|
return -ENOMEM;
|
||||||
|
Loading…
Reference in New Issue
Block a user